Krakow has become a magnet for tech talent, blending a vibrant startup scene with a strong academic base from Jagiellonian University and AGH. The city offers a high quality of life, lower living costs than Warsaw, and a growing network of coworking spaces, accelerators, and meet‑ups that keep talent connected.

The tech ecosystem in Krakow spans fintech, AI, gaming, SaaS, and cloud services. Companies such as Allegro, PayU, Brainly, CD Projekt, and Microsoft Poland hire full‑stack engineers, data scientists, and product specialists. Start‑ups in the Nowa Huta district and established firms in the Wawel area collaborate on AI research, e‑commerce platforms, and gaming engines.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of tech jobs are available in Krakow?
Krakow hosts a wide range of tech roles, from entry‑level software developers (front‑end, back‑end, mobile) and DevOps engineers to mid‑level data scientists, AI researchers, product managers, UX/UI designers, cybersecurity analysts, and fintech specialists. Senior engineers and technical leads also find opportunities in larger firms and scale‑ups.
Is remote work common in Krakow’s tech sector?
Hybrid models dominate, with many companies offering 2–3 days on‑site per week and the rest remote. Fully remote roles are still available, especially in multinational firms like Google Poland and Amazon. Local coworking hubs such as KUB, Galeria Krakowska, and Hub Hub allow remote workers to stay connected.
Which major employers are hiring tech talent in Krakow?
Key players in Krakow include Google Poland, Amazon, IBM, Allegro, PayU, Brainly, CD Projekt, Microsoft Poland, Accenture, TCS, Oracle, and Penta. Start‑ups like Miro, Replit, and Synthetik also bring significant hiring activity.
What are the salary expectations for tech roles in Krakow?
Base gross salaries for tech roles in Krakow generally range from PLN 80,000–120,000 for junior positions, PLN 120,000–180,000 for mid‑level, and PLN 180,000–260,000 for senior or lead roles, with additional bonuses and equity. Net take‑home after tax is roughly 55–60% of gross, so a senior engineer can expect around PLN 110,000–150,000 net per year.
